Ronnie Dunn Praises Morgan Wallen, Calls Him ‘One of the Most Talented Singer-Songwriters in a Long Time’

Country music star Morgan Wallen received high praise from Ronnie Dunn on his SiriusXm’s radio show, Ronnie Dunn’s Road Trip when Dunn called him “one of the most talented singer/songwriters in a long time.”

Country music fans nationwide consider Dunn a modern-day country legend, and praise from the veteran is not given freely. For the frequently quieter half of the duo, Brooks & Dunn, to serve such high praise is rare. “The kid” has some major aptitude as a country artist with such a profound observation coming from the legend himself.

Wallen has had numerous songs reach the top of the charts, including multiple number ones. Dunn had just finished playing “Talkin’ Tennessee” when he shouted out the younger artist.

“Talkin’ Tennessee,” premiered on Wallen’s 2018 album, If I Know Me, and the star still has additional tracks from this album finding the spotlight three years later. Previous examples include “The Way I Talk” (2016), “Up Down” featuring Florida Georgia Line (2017), and “Whiskey Glasses” (2018).

Dunn and Wallen were previously seen together at the younger star’s label, Big Loud. Following this, there was speculation among country music fans about a potential artist collaboration, a treat for country music fans all over.

Seth England, Big Loud Records’ CEO, posted the photo this past May. He captioned it, “Two of the very best singers to ever walk music row…The voice that got me into country music…and the voice that keeps me going.”

Wallen not only has the support and admiration of country legend Ronnie Dunn but also seems to be one of “The Chief” Eric Church’s friends and mentees as well.

Often we are accustomed to country artists working professional collaborations in the studio or on the stage. However, fans went wild on Instagram when Wallen shared a video of the pair simply jamming out to the younger artist’s “Sand In My Boots.” In the background, viewers also spot newcomer country star Hardy and veteran Darius Rucker.

Despite the artist’s young age and unique self-image, he has attracted a highly diverse and talented group of artists. Wallen also makes an appearance on Hardy’s album, Hixtape, on the tracks “He Went To Jared” and “Turn You Down.”
